Facebook for Windows Phone updated to include push notifications

By Tom Warren, on 30th Jun 11 6:33 am with 16 Comments

Microsoft has issued an updated for its Facebook Windows Phone application.

The update delivers push notifications to Facebook, clearly an interim solution ahead of built-in native notification support in Windows Phone Mango. The notification settings allow users to pick between Message, Wall Post, Feed comment, Feed comment reply, Photo tag, Photo comment, Tagged photo comment, Photo comment reply etc. Facebook users can also turn on toasts and a live tile count for the notifications, there’s three options available:

  • No Push Notifications
  • Toasts and Tile count
  • Tile Count Only

WPCentral notes that the app now feels a lot smoother and more complete. Facebook for Windows Phone also requests access to sensors on devices and phone identity, presumably for future additional features. Facebook for Windows Phone 2.0 is available immediately in the Windows Phone Marketplace.
